INSTRUCTIONS FOR PRESENTATIONS TO THE BOARD BY PARENTS AND CITIZENS
Allegiance STEAM Academy- Thrive charter schools (“Allegiance STEAM Academy”), also known as ASA Thrive, are direct-funded, independent, public charter schools operated by the Allegiance STEAM Academy nonprofit public benefit corporation and governed by Allegiance STEAM Academy, Incorporated corporate Board of Directors (“Board”). The purpose of a public meeting of the Board, is to conduct the affairs of Allegiance STEAM Academy in public. We are pleased that you are in attendance and hope you will visit these meetings often. Your participation assures us of continuing community interest in our school.
1. Agendas are available to all audience members at the meeting. Note that the order of business on this agenda may be changed without prior notice. For more information on this agenda, please contact Allegiance at: info@asathrive.org
2. “Request to Speak” forms are available to all audience members who wish to speak on any agenda items or under the general category of “Public Comments.” Members of the public who wish to speak are encouraged to complete a Request to Speak card to assist in organizing comments. Submitting a card is not required in order to address the Board.
3. “Public Comments” are set aside for members of the audience to comment. However, due to public meeting laws, the Board can only listen to your issue, not take action. The public is invited to address the Board regarding items listed on the agenda. Comments on an agenda item will be accepted during consideration of that item, or prior to consideration of the item in the case of a closed session item. Please turn in comment cards to the Board Secretary prior to the item you wish to speak on. Members of the public may join the meeting via Zoom (link above) and will be given an opportunity to speak. To provide public comment through Zoom, please use the ‘Raise Hand’ feature during the Public Comments section or when prompted by the Board President. These presentations are limited to three (3) minutes.

V. Communications
A.
Communications
S. Cognetta
Share employee perspective on state COLA; total percentage carries all operational costs, not indexed solely to salaries. Dive in further, example of health benefits. Increase ASA's employee obligations to benefits - opportunities to help staff.
S. Thompson
No comments.
S. Odo
Have a great summer, enjoy some relaxing time off.
S. Bhojani
Budget standpoint; context of reserves vs state/county requirements. Look into allocating more to salaries and how it would effect our budgets. Have a great summer.
J. Kaakuahiwi
Good point made by S. Bhojani. It is not unlikely for a charter school in California to have high reserves - allows a cushion for difficult times.
M. Jones
School has been conservative since joining the Board. We have a great staff!
